This week I was rung by a male saying he was ringing from Telstra in relation to our phone.
He told me as a rewards package we were to get free line rental, free calls etc. When I became suspicious and refused to give him my date of birth he then said if I did not give this information our phone would be cut off immediately.
At this stage I ended the call and immediately rang Telstra, who were particularly helpful and said it was indeed a scam and the caller was trying to access personal information from me to benefit him/ them.
Beware these calls and never give date of birth or other relevant information. He sounded quite genuine until I refused to give him the in information he wanted then he became almost abusive. Beware.
